YY_More

  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

2011年8月1日

摘要: 还是四边形不等式的题目。//By YY_More#include<cstdio>int x[1001],sum[1001],n,m,temp,s[1001][1001],f[1001][1001];inline int cal(int a,int b){ return x[b]-x[a-1]-sum[a-1]*(sum[b]-sum[a-1]);} int main(){ while (~scanf("%d%d",&n,&m)){ if (n==0) break; sum[0]=0;x[0]=0; for(int i=1;i<=n;i++) 阅读全文
posted @ 2011-08-01 13:41 YY_More 阅读(273) 评论(0) 推荐(0) 编辑

摘要: 经典的四边形不等式优化,可以达到O(VP)。不过网上很多人的程序对四边形不等式应用的不好,他们那么写是达不到O(VP)的。//By YY_More#include<cstdio>int x[301],sum[301],f[35][310],s[35][310],V,P,temp; inline int cal(int a,int b){ int k=(a+b)/2; return -sum[k-1]+sum[a-1]+sum[b]-sum[k]+x[k]*(k+k-a-b);} int main(){ scanf("%d%d",&V,&P); f 阅读全文
posted @ 2011-08-01 11:05 YY_More 阅读(283) 评论(0) 推荐(0) 编辑